I was looking for some information about 2 films for someone that will be showing them in a couple of months on the big screen.

One is called Shadow of the Dragon, it's a 1970s kung fu film starring Michael Heung.

The other is called Black Belt. The only information at this time is that there are scenes with guys in safari hats.

Any information about their real titles, directors, the studio that made them, stars, or any facts about their production will be greatly appreciated. The owner of these films is looking for anything about these movies to share with the audience.

BLACK BELT is probably the rare basher with Ma Cheung and perennial Shaolin abbott O Yau Man. I don't know anything about it other than it was released in 1973. The same year, Pai Ying was in a film called THE BLACK BELT, but I don't think that's the one you're looking for because the Ma Cheung movie has guys in safari hats in the poster/cover art (I think).

I'm pretty sure SHADOW OF THE DRAGON is on one of those trailer compilations - Celluloid Fury or Bruce Lee Mania or something. No idea what its real title is, though, or who "Michael Heung" actually is.

Michael Heung is actually Charles Heung, whose father was the founder of the Sun Yee On Triad and ex-husband of Betty Ting Pei, the actress whose apartment where Bruce Lee died. Charles has said up and down he had no affiliation with his father's gang.

Currently, Charles is the founder of Chinastar Entertainment, and works alongside current wife Tiffany Chen.
